A secret that could have prevented the atomic bomb. A ghost who waited forty years to tell it. A special child who was the only one who could hear him. In 1981, the quiet, ordered world of the Grayson family is shattered when their non-verbal, autistic son, Luke, begins to draw WWII fighter planes with impossible accuracy and whisper clues from a life he never lived. The memories belong to James Harrison, a brilliant pilot shot down in 1945 while protecting a dangerous truth: a strategic insight that could have rewritten the end of the war. To heal their son, the Graysons must partner with a cynical journalist to unravel a decades-old military conspiracy, a journey that will take them from forgotten archives to a secret hearing in the halls of Congress. There, they must stake everything on the testimony of their son, forcing the most powerful men in the world to confront a truth delivered by the quietest, most marginalized voice. But the legacy of their discovery is greater than they could ever imagine. As the Cold War rages, the ghost's forgotten wisdom finds its way to the White House, influencing the very strategy that will peacefully bring down the Berlin Wall. Spanning from the battlefields of the Pacific to the fall of the Soviet Union, and ending with a final, poignant mystery in the present day, The Lucas Legacy is a story about the echoes of history, the courage of the forgotten, and the profound, world-changing power of a child who the world saw as broken, but who was, in fact, the key to everything.
